This report summarizes the findings of the third wave of AMI' s quarterly tracker (Q-Pulse) survey conducted among small (1-99 employees) and medium (100-999) businesses (SMBs) in Mexico. The survey was completed among a representative sample of the top business decision makers and/or technology decision makers during September and October of 2009.

These findings were compared to the first and second waves of Q-Pulse (QP1 2009 and QP2 2009), and prior AMI survey research (Q4 2008), as relevant.

The main study objectives include the following:

  • Understanding the impact of the economic environment on IT purchase decision-making from an SMB perspective.
  • Identifying IT and telecom-related mindsets, attitudes, expectations, purchases and plans from a quarterly perspective as they unfold during 2009 in particular as the impact of the economic stimulus is felt and the current recession gives way to an improving economy.
  • Determining shifts in ICT quarterly spending (QoQ) by comparison across major product categories.
  • Tracking changes in buying process and buying criteria.
